Christ Lutheran has been making potato klub, a form of dumpling, just as long, and with the merger of Augustana Lutheran after the 2011 flood, it also incorporated Augustana's rice pudding tradition. Høstfest grew out of the celebration by Minot Lutheran churches of the 150th anniversary of Norwegian immigration in 1975, and food always has been a part of the festivity. Kari Files, Instructor of Organ, received her BA in Music from St. Olaf College; her BSE from Minot State University; and her Master's Degree in Church Music with an Organ Emphasis, from Concordia University Wisconsin, in Mequon.
